Technical Specifications

Parameter NameValue
TypeParameter
Package / Case SOIC
Surface MountYES
Number of Pins 8
Weight 75.891673mg
JESD-609 Code e4
Moisture Sensitivity Level (MSL) 3 (168 Hours)
Number of Terminations 8
ECCN Code EAR99
Resistance 100GOhm
Terminal Finish Nickel/Palladium/Gold (Ni/Pd/Au)
Max Operating Temperature125°C
Min Operating Temperature -40°C
Subcategory Instrumentation Amplifier
Technology BIPOLAR
Terminal Position DUAL
Terminal FormGULL WING
Peak Reflow Temperature (Cel) 260
Number of Functions 1
Supply Voltage 15V
Pin Count8
Number of Elements 3
Temperature GradeINDUSTRIAL
Number of Channels 1
Max Supply Voltage36V
Min Supply Voltage4.5V
Operating Supply Current 700μA
Nominal Supply Current750μA
Quiescent Current700μA
Slew Rate4 V/μs
Amplifier Type INSTRUMENTATION AMPLIFIER
Common Mode Rejection Ratio 120 dB
Current - Input Bias 5nA
Output Current per Channel 15mA
Input Offset Voltage (Vos) 10μV
Bandwidth 1.3MHz
Neg Supply Voltage-Nom (Vsup) -15V
Voltage Gain 80dB
Average Bias Current-Max (IIB) 0.005μA
Max Dual Supply Voltage18V
-3db Bandwidth 1.3MHz
Min Dual Supply Voltage 2.25V
Dual Supply Voltage 15V
Input Offset Current-Max (IIO) 0.005μA
Input Voltage Noise Density 8nV/sqrt Hz
Voltage Gain-Nom 10
Non-linearity-Max 0.002%
Height 1.58mm
Length 4.9mm
Width 3.91mm
Radiation HardeningNo
RoHS StatusRoHS Compliant
Lead Free Lead Free
